> So... Again, what is Yhgc? Please expand your commit message, MAINTAINERS
> and Kconfig entries. (this is a usual thing: if you get a review question, it
> usually means that you need to provide more information _in_ the patch
> rather than just reporting on the mailing list). I'd suggest adding full company
> name and maybe a website as a comment inside the driver code. Otherwise it
> would be very hard to assess in few years whether it's something that is still in
> use, whether it needs improvements, etc.
>
This is a spelling error, it should be YHGCH. which has been corrected and is 
now in uppercase. The chip introduction has been added to the commit message, 
and the company's website has been included in the MAINTAINERS file and the 
source code.
